Without a doubt, the use of essential smart gadgets such as mobile phones and computers has become a complex skill that regularly causes problems for elderly people. Recent technological advances, mainly to enhance the graphical user interface, are passively increasing the complexity. However, it can be resolved by introducing a dedicated category of products with hardware and software with certain easy-to-operate aspects.
Within the last 5 years, the innovation in silicon chips has enabled smartphones and laptops to provide a huge amount of processing power, including the capability to handle complex graphics-related processes. This has caused a problem for the older generation, which cannot use them for their daily activities. For example, social media applications such as Facebook, Snapchat, and Instagram have changed their visual aspects more than 100 times in the last couple of years. Manufacturing companies are now trying to use more images rather than words to perform certain tasks. Because of this, when an image that has been used for a significant period, gets changed on a smartphone, it causes immense trouble for users other than the young generation.
However, the solution to this problem is really simple. In fact, it doesn’t even require much investment in the software and hardware industries. If they produce cell phones and computers with a user interface that uses more words than images or icons, it would allow everyone to understand the usage of such products very easily. Take the example of the camera in a cell phone. All it takes is to provide a description of the application under the image in a more readable sense to alleviate this issue. Although it will not be an easy change and may not be welcomed by youngsters too quickly, manufacturers can simply provide an easy switch between these two different categories of digital devices to make both parties happy.
In conclusion, smartphones and other essential gadgets have the purpose of reducing the efforts required to operate them and allowing the user to get the work done in the easiest way possible. The clutter caused by such device upgrades has caused a problem for older customers. But it is possible to resolve it without causing any huge economic burden by creating a separate set of products for them.
